Cleanroom Demands for Vertical Labeling Equipment

The application of labels in pharmaceutical settings often occurs within controlled environments. A vertical labeling machine must adhere to specific cleanroom standards to maintain area integrity. Materials and Surface Compliance

All exposed surfaces on the machine require specific materials. Stainless steel or anodized aluminum are common for their cleanability and low particulate shedding. Control of Particulate Generation

The mechanical operation of a vertical labeling machine must minimize air disruption. Bearings, drives, and moving parts are enclosed or designed to function without releasing lubricants or debris. Design for Efficient Sanitization

Equipment design must allow for thorough and rapid cleaning. Rounded corners, seamless welds, and minimized horizontal surfaces prevent particle accumulation.
